On Saturday, August 23, 2025, President Scott Feller hoisted Caleb Mills Bell and rang in 270 members of the Class of 2029 to the ranks of Wabash men.

Fun facts on the Class

  • Members of the Class of 2029 hail from high schools with mascots that are Thunderbolts (4), Grizzly Cubs (3), Gryphons (2), Achaean, Alice, Archangel, Chameleon, Red Rambler, Wildkit, and Zebra.
  • Five are the 3rd member of their households to attend Wabash; on is the 8th family member to attend Wabash going all the way back to the Class of 1947.
  • One is one of 6 children, and another is the youngest of 6. One has 7 siblings, and one is the oldest of 9 children.
  • This class also includes 3 twins. One pair is enrolling here while the third’s twin sister is enrolling elsewhere.
  • One is a newlywed.
  • This class includes a licensed welder, a painter, and dozens of musicians including the drummer of the band Splitrise, and one who can play 4 instruments.
  • The class boasts several vocalists as well including one classmate whose choir performed on America’s Got Talent and earned the Golden Buzzer from Simon Cowell.
  • One classmate has lived in 9 different states. One has traveled to more than 25 countries, and another traveled to more than 30.
  • One member endured surgeries on both knees and in his words have “pretty much iron knees.”
  • One is a cancer survivor.
  • The Class of 2029 include someone with an eidetic memory, the founder of a candy company, a Diamond 1 on Rainbow Six Siege, a black belt in judo, a cat socialization expert, a knight who does battle in medieval combat competitions, and the host of a gameshow on YouTube called ERGSTIE (Epic Reality Game Show That Involves Elimination).

Wabash Liberal Arts Immersion Program

The Wabash Liberal Arts Immersion Program (WLAIP) is designed to give exceptional students a head start on:

  • earning credits towards their Wabash degree.
  • learning about and interacting with the offices and people who can help them succeed at Wabash. 
  • understanding what makes a Wabash education rigorous, unique, and important.
  • preparing for success after they graduate from Wabash.
